Kien Tuong: Taking care of works honoring martyrs

On the occasion of the 78th anniversary of War Invalids and Martyrs Day (July 27, 1947 - July 27, 2025), on the morning of July 15, the Vietnam Fatherland Front Committee and socio-political organizations, and mass organizations of Kien Tuong ward, Tay Ninh province took action to take care of and clean up works honoring martyrs in the ward.

Vietnam Fatherland Front Committee, socio -political organizations and mass organizations of Kien Tuong ward take action to take care of and clean up works honoring martyrs.

With sincere and grateful hearts, more than 400 cadres, members, youth union members, armed forces of the ward and students of Kien Tuong High School cleaned the area of ​​the Memorial Temple for martyrs who sacrificed their lives during the Tet Offensive in 1968. At the same time, they cleaned the grounds of Moc Hoa - Kien Tuong Martyrs Cemetery; replaced old flowers and placed new flowers at the martyrs' graves, creating a clean and beautiful environment.

Mr. Nguyen Minh Quang (Youth Union of Kien Tuong Water Supply and Environment Joint Stock Company) shared: "This activity not only raises awareness among union members and young people about the good traditions and morality of "When drinking water, remember its source" of the nation, but also the responsibility, sacred feelings, and gratitude of today's young generation towards the previous generation".

Moc Hoa - Kien Tuong Martyrs Cemetery is the resting place of 1,336 heroes and martyrs, of which 683 graves are unknown.

Over the past time, with the investment attention of the State and the joint care of the people, these works are always clean, beautiful, spacious, becoming "red addresses" to educate traditions for today's and future generations./.
